Historical Description:  The Brunswick Skull (Brunswick Totenkopf) entered the 20th century as a long-standing emblem of the Duchy of Brunswick’s military heritage, with origins dating back to the Black Brunswickers of the Napoleonic Wars. By the late Imperial and interwar periods, its use had become codified within certain traditional German cavalry formations, most notably the 2nd and 17th Brunswick-affiliated Hussar regiments, which retained the skull as a hereditary symbol of regional identity and remembrance. Unlike later political uses of skull imagery, the Brunswick design reflected lineage, mourning for the fallen dukes of Brunswick, and the legacy of the 1809 anti-Napoleonic volunteer corps.

In the years leading up to World War II, as the German military was reorganized and expanded under the Wehrmacht, some successor units and veterans’ organizations continued to reference this older tradition. The Brunswick Skull, where it appeared, was employed in a historical and regimental context rather than as an ideological emblem, maintaining a visual continuity with the cavalry heritage of the pre-1918 German Army. Its presence in this era thus represented the survival of a regional military symbol rooted in the 19th century, distinct from and predating the politicized skull motifs adopted by certain groups during the Nazi period.
